Jock Lewis died in the Paddington train crash. Or did he? His fiancée Minty is coming to terms with both his loss and the loss of all her savings, which Jock vanished with.

And there is Zilla, who had been married to a man called Jerry Leach. She also received a letter from the railway company telling her that her husband is dead.

Other women, too, who do not know each other, have all had relationships with a dark-haired man who disappears from their lives.

And when Jock's ghost reappears to Minty at her home and at her work, she begins to carry a knife... but if she stabs him, will he bleed?


Another excellent read from Rendell, where the lives of strangers are woven together through a mixture of murder, misunderstandings & madness. It's fascinating the way in which the actions of one person can, unbeknownst to them, have such terrible consequences on someone else.....& it's so hard not to pity poor Minty - recommend it :o)
